    querying on a number field using a string

    Good night all.



    I have a field of numeric data type in my table. This field contains numbers as well as blanks. in my query I want to return all records with blanks. I tried this by using 2 quotations marks like so "" but what I get is a message saying invalid data type. Is there a means of getting around this problem?
